Because it can’t be said enough right now. North America. So much of our culture either IS black culture or stems from it. Just look at music. Pretty much everything we like can be traced back to Black American traditions like blues, ragtime, rock and roll, and jazz. Even something as simple and ubiquitous as having the snare/clap on the 2s and 4s can be traced back to these traditions. And that alone covers probably more than 90% of the songs you listen to. And when it’s not the 2 and the 4, it’s usually the distinctly Afro-Cuban Tresillo/Dembow rhythm (think Despacito or One Dance). And that’s just one element, of one field. I’m obviously barely scratching the surface. The point is, it runs deep. We love black culture. We consume it, we’re inspired by it, we adapt it, we pull from it… And I think that can be beautiful (when done respectfully). I mean, that’s what culture is.
